In the rapidly evolving world of foldable laptops, the Asus Zenbook 17 Fold Ux9702 and the Lenovo Thinkpad X1 Fold stand out as two of the most innovative options available. Both devices aim to redefine portability and versatility, but which one truly offers the better experience? This comparison explores their features, design, performance, and overall value to help you decide.
Design and Build Quality
The Asus Zenbook 17 Fold Ux9702 features a sleek, modern design with a premium aluminum chassis. Its 17.3-inch foldable OLED display provides a vibrant viewing experience, and the hinge mechanism is durable, allowing smooth folding and unfolding. The device is relatively lightweight for its size, making it portable for daily use.
Conversely, the Lenovo Thinkpad X1 Fold emphasizes a classic Thinkpad aesthetic with a sturdy magnesium and aluminum build. Its 13.3-inch foldable screen is compact and lightweight, designed for mobility. The hinge is robust, ensuring longevity and stability during use. The device also features a built-in kickstand for multiple usage modes.
Display and Multimedia
The Asus Zenbook boasts a 17.3-inch OLED display with 2560×1920 resolution, delivering stunning visuals with deep blacks and vibrant colors. Its large screen is ideal for multitasking, content creation, and entertainment.
The Lenovo Thinkpad X1 Fold offers a 13.3-inch foldable OLED display with 2048×1536 resolution. While smaller, it still provides sharp and bright visuals suitable for productivity tasks and media consumption. The device supports multiple usage modes, including laptop, tablet, and tent modes.
Performance and Hardware
The Asus Zenbook Ux9702 is powered by Intel’s latest processors, with options including the Core i7 series. It comes with up to 16GB of RAM and fast SSD storage, ensuring smooth multitasking and quick data access. Its performance is well-suited for demanding applications and creative work.
The Lenovo Thinkpad X1 Fold features Intel Core processors, typically from the 11th generation, with configurations supporting up to 16GB of RAM and SSD storage. While capable for most productivity tasks, it may not match the raw power of the Zenbook for intensive workloads.
Keyboard, Input, and Connectivity
The Asus Zenbook includes a detachable keyboard that provides a comfortable typing experience. It also features a precision touchpad, stylus support, and multiple USB-C ports for connectivity.
The Lenovo Thinkpad X1 Fold comes with an optional Bluetooth keyboard and stylus, offering flexibility for input. It supports Wi-Fi 6, Bluetooth 5.1, and has a variety of ports, including Thunderbolt 4, making it versatile for different peripherals.
Battery Life and Portability
The Asus Zenbook’s larger display consumes more power, resulting in an estimated battery life of around 8-10 hours under typical use. Its size and weight are manageable for a 17-inch device, but it remains more suitable for stationary work or travel where power sources are available.
The Lenovo Thinkpad X1 Fold offers better portability with its smaller size and lighter weight. Its battery life is approximately 8 hours, making it suitable for on-the-go productivity without frequent recharging.
